MPT acquires Amherstburg Solar Park

On June 23, 2010, MPT acquired a 20-megawatt solar photovoltaic (PV) power project in Ontario, to be designed, built and operated on MPT’s behalf by U.S.-based SunPower, a world leader in solar power with a 10-year track record of establishing successful commercial-scale facilities in Spain, Portugal, Germany, Italy and the United States. Celebrating Global Wind Day at Erie Shores Wind Farm

On June 15, 2010, the Canadian Wind Energy Association hosted a tour of MPT's Erie Shores Wind Farm to demonstrate how wind turbines work and the economic opportunities they create for the communities that host them. Read more

Future plans for Cardinal Power

Dennis Dmytrow, general manager of Cardinal Power, addressed attendees at the annual COGENCanada conference on June 3, 2010 in Toronto, explaining how existing gas cogeneration non-utility generators (NUGs) such as Cardinal Power are good for Ontario’s future. Read more
